The Hope Collective: A Space for Reflection, Creation, and Connection

The Hope Collective is an informal alliance of organizations advancing reflection, collaboration, and creative exploration around hope’s role in society and education.

Organized by International Baccalaureate, Ready Generations, Salzburg Global, and the Shirley Chisholm Cultural Institute

Event Description

Featuring mixed media artist Al Johnson, whose bold work sparks dialogue, this convening invites engagement through art, equity, and lived experience. Committed to inclusion, it offers a space where every voice is valued, and hope becomes a tool for change.
